Luther, Montana Luther is an unincorporated community in Carbon County, Montana, United States. Luther lies on Montana Highway 78 southeast of Roscoe and northwest of Red Lodge. Luther was originally called Linley. Its first post office was established on March 12, 1902 with Walter R (...) Roscoe, Montana Roscoe is a census-designated place and unincorporated community in Carbon County, Montana, United States. As of the 2010 census it had a population of 15. Roscoe depends on light tourism and features a guest ranch, the Pioneer Pottery, and the Grizzly Bar & Grill. (...) KMXE-FM KMXE-FM is a commercial radio station in Red Lodge, Montana, broadcasting on 99.3 FM. It is owned by Silver Rock Communications in Red Lodge, and airs an adult hits music format, branded as “The Mountain”. The studios are at 9 South Broadway, Red Lodge (...)
